Philippe Maillard is a scholar working on Global and Planetary Change, Water Science and Technology and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Philippe Maillard has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 614 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Global and Planetary Change, 14 papers in Water Science and Technology and 12 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Philippe Maillard’s work include Flood Risk Assessment and Management (10 papers),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ications (9 papers) and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(9 papers). Philippe Maillard is often cited by papers focused on Flood Risk Assessment and Management (10 papers),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ications (9 papers) and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(9 papers). Philippe Maillard coll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, Canada and France. Philippe Maillard's co-authors include David A. Clausi, Huawu Deng, Stéphane Calmant, Camila C. Amorim, Peter Yu, A. K. Qin, Patrick Rößler, Andreas J. Heinrich, Johannes Lang and Keiller Nogueira and has published in prestigious journ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Remote Sensing of Environment and IEEE Transactions on Geoscience and Remote Sensing.
